Dubbing
Easy Dubbing from HDD deck to VHS deck
Because this recorder includes both HDD deck and VHS deck, you can easily use it for dubbing up to eight programmes (or play lists) without connecting any other equipment.
A Access the HDD Navigation screen.
Slide TV/CABLE/SAT to the right, then press HDD, then press EDIT.
B Access the Easy Dubbing screen.
?
Press w r e t to move the arrow to �EDITING�, then press OK.
C Select the programme(s).
Press w r e t to move the arrow to the desired programme index, then press OK when you dub only one programme (or play list). The message for preparing a cassette appears.
� When you want to select more programmes, press MEMO instead of pressing OK after selecting the desired programme. The playback order numbers appear on the index. After all the programmes (or play lists) desired for dubbing are selected, press OK. � If you want to correct playback order, move the arrow to the desired index and press MEMO. The number is deleted and the recorder automatically renumbers the other programmes (or play lists). � If you want to cancel the current playback order, press &.
